Shortening days in Santiago de Cuba through October 1941

In Santiago de Cuba, Cuba, October 1941 is a month when the day shrinks: from 11h 57m at the start to 11h 24m by the end, a swing of about 33 minutes. That works out to roughly 7 minutes a week.

The earliest sunrise falls at 05:54 on October 1 and the latest at 06:04 on October 31, while sunset ranges from 17:29 on October 30 to 17:51 on October 1.
